Nevertheless, this shiny new tool comes with responsibilities. Just like nature’s balance relies on informed stewardship, using Chat GPT wisely depends on critical oversight. The AI can sometimes suggest outdated or regionally inappropriate tips. It might recommend ornamental plants that don’t survive in Czech winters or suggest soil amendments that run counter to local organic standards. Gardeners should treat AI answers as helpful drafts—useful starting points—but always cross-check against trusted sources or local climate data. In practice, a Czech gardener might receive a suggestion to underplant with lavender beneath grapevines—but they should validate whether lavender thrives in local soil conditions. Chat GPT might offer soil pH ranges or watering techniques, yet the final garden plan should reflect the gardener’s hands-on observations and regional weather patterns.
